Biofeedback to improve walking for diabetic nerve damage
Part of Hormones & metabolism clinical trials.
This study tests a special biofeedback system to help people with diabetic nerve damage walk better. You'll use sensors during treadmill walking to see if real-time feedback can improve your stride and balance.

Who can take part
- You can walk about 30 feet (10 meters) on your own without a cane or walker.
- You have been diagnosed with diabetes and diabetic nerve damage in your feet.
- You are healthy enough to walk on a treadmill for 6 minutes at a comfortable pace.
- You have had a foot checkup within the last 6 months and have your doctor's OK to take part.
